When Moles Are A Worry: Specialists In Dermatology: A melanocyte (mole) is a particular kind of pigment-producing cell that lives in the skin. These melanocytes are located occasionally in "normal" skin, however can expand in nests to develop moles. Dermatofibromas might happen anywhere on the body, yet they are specifically usual on the extremities. They are thought to be an action to some minor trauma such as an insect bite or a medical injection. As a matter of fact, among the factors they are so typical on women's legs is that they stand for a response to nicking the skin while shaving. Dermatofibromas might be a problem, however unless they are really bothersome, skin doctors usually advise leaving them alone.

The most effective means to stop melanoma is to restrict direct exposure to sunlight. Having a suntan or sunburn indicates that the skin has been damaged by the sunlight, and proceeded tanning or burning enhances the risk of creating cancer malignancy. Often the very first sign of cancer malignancy is a modification in the shape, color, dimension, or feel of an existing mole.
